As the Boston Red Sox celebrated their World Series victory with a “rolling rally” on Saturday, the parade of duck boats stopped at the Boston Marathon finish line on Boylston Street to pay tribute to the bombing victims.
http://twitter.com/#!/ScottIsaacs/status/396650637448200192
A Boston Strong jersey with the city’s area code, 617, was placed on the World Series trophy at the finish line.
